KWR137
KWR137 is an orally active Werner protein (WRN) inhibitor with a human IC50 of 8 nM. KWR137 inhibits the ATPase activity required for WRN helicase function, induces WRN protein degradation, suppresses cancer cell proliferation, and slows tumor growth without causing weight loss or off-target effects. KWR137 can be used for the research of colorectal cancer.

KWR137 (compound 10i) (3-4 days) inhibits proliferation of MSI-H colorectal cancer cell lines SW48 (GI50 = 0.509 μM) and HCT116 (GI50 = 0.824 μM), but has minimal activity against MSS colorectal cancer cell line SW620 (GI50 > 20 μM)[1].
KWR137 potently inhibits the ATPase activity of purified full-length human WRN protein with an IC50 of 8 nM[1].
KWR137 (10 μM; 18 h) induces WRN protein degradation in MSI-H colorectal cancer cell lines SW48 and HCT116, but not in MSS colorectal cancer cell line SW620[1].

| Species | Dose | Route | Tmax | Cmax | T1/2 | AUClast | MRTlast |
|---|---|---|---|---|---|---|---|
| Mice[1] | 10 mg/kg | p.o. | 1.0 h | 0.6 μg/mL | 1.99 h | 2.61 μg·h/mL | 2.94 h |

Animal Model:NOD/SCID mice[1]
-
Dosage:40 mg/kg
-
Administration:p.o.; once daily; 14 days
-
Result:Achieved a tumor growth inhibition rate of 49.3%.
Reduced tumor weight compared to vehicle control.
Caused no body weight loss or off-target effects.
